Celebrating & Supporting Women at the Hilton
International Women’s Day (IWD) has been celebrated worldwide since 1911. This day aims to inspire gender equality and eliminate bias, stereotypes, and discrimination while promoting diversity, fairness, and inclusion.
Every year, on March 8th, the island is reminded of these values and the importance of collectively celebrating achievements and raising awareness about prominent issues.
At the Hilton Aruba Caribbean Resort & Casino, IWD activities were spread across several days in March. The most memorable event was the Women’s Café, where team members gathered over coffee, cookies, and snacks to discuss important topics in small groups at round tables.
Each group shared insights from team members and professionals, discussing topics such as balancing career and family life, healthy aging, nurturing spirituality, and staying true to oneself. It became evident that women at the tables shared similar dilemmas and pondered similar existential questions. The sisterhood that formed during the discussions facilitated connections between participants from different departments and age groups.
The forum also featured a candid and insightful talk by Marisol Croes, who shared her personal journey in defining her individual identity.
The purposeful and enthusiastic women at the Hilton celebrated the day by supporting and motivating each other, fostering a deep sense of community and empathy.
The event was organized by the Department of Human Resources, with Nicole Hart from Ama Lurra Consultancy Coaching and Training playing a key role.
